Output 31e80f73706c98c328b132b287788051eae2bcb8fb15e18fb28c1eed5791d034:0

value
34413172
script pubkey
OP_0 OP_PUSHBYTES_20 0c0ba89e67eac5406a30cefbcd0c839af2052975
address
ltc1qps9638n8atz5q63semau6ryrnteq22t48wjg2n
transaction
31e80f73706c98c328b132b287788051eae2bcb8fb15e18fb28c1eed5791d034
spent
true